Significance

Ranirestat is a potent inhibitor of aldose reductase that is in phase III clinical trials for the treatment of diabetic complications. The key step in the synthesis depicted is the efficient asymmetric addition of the β-keto ester A to the azodicarboxylate B catalyzed by ligand C and La(Oi-Pr )3.
